Before the incident
Repairing beet bucket inside beet elevator
What happened
While turning the elevator shaft the weight of the bucket caused the elevator to continue rotating. In an attempt to stop the shaft the employee used a pipe wrench resulting in his right middle finger becoming caught between the pipe wrench and the elevator shaft.
Injury or illness
Fracture to right middle finger
Object or substance involved
Pipe wrench and elevator shaft
Summary line
Fracture to right middle finger from getting finger caught between pipe wrench and main drive shaft
